Blog API Backend Blog API Backend Blog API Backend Blog API Backend Blog API Backend
تفاصيل العمل

This project is a fully functional RESTful API for a blogging platform, built with Node.js, Express.js, and TypeScript. It’s designed with clean architecture and scalability in mind, suitable for both web and mobile applications. 🔑 Key Features: Post Management: Create, read, update, and delete blog posts. Categories & Tags: Organize posts with categories and tags, supporting relations between posts. User Authentication & Authorization: Secure login and registration with JWT, including role-based access (Admin/User). Database Management: Built with PostgreSQL/MySQL using Sequelize, handling relations efficiently. Project Structure: Organized using MVC pattern, making the code clean, readable, and maintainable. Advanced Features: Pagination, filtering, and sorting for posts. 🛠 Technologies Used: Node.js & Express.js for backend JavaScript (ES6+) for server-side logic Sequelize ORM for database interactions JWT for authentication PostgreSQL/MySQL as the database This project helped me strengthen my skills in SQL, Sequelize relations, backend API design, and organizing a scalable Node.js application

شارك
بطاقة العمل
تاريخ النشر
منذ 3 أيام
المشاهدات
10
المستقل
طلب عمل مماثل
شارك
مركز المساعدة